Correlation between Parity, Birth Interval, and the Frequency of Antenatal Care towards the Incidence of Low Birth Weight Babies in RSUD Dr. Mohammad Soewandhie Surabaya

Abstract

Low Birth Weight (LBW) contributes to 60% to 80% of all neonatal and infant deaths in Indonesia whilst globally, prevalence of LBW is 15.5%, amounting to approximately 20 million LBW infants born each year. According to several previous studies, factors closely related with the incidence of LBW are high birth rates, shorter birth intervals, and low frequency of Antenatal Care (ANC) examinations. The objective of this study was to determine the correlation between parity, birth interval, and the frequency of ANC towards the incidence of LBW babies. This retrospective cross-sectional study using simple random sampling involved 95 mothers in RSUD Dr. Mohammad Soewandhie Surabaya between January and July 2016. Data was collected using medical records and analyzed using logistic regression test with p < 0.05. The result of this research showed there was no correlations between parity and incidence of LBW babies (p=0.162) nor between birth interval and incidence of LBW babies (p=0.574). There was a correlation between frequency of ANC and incidence of LBW babies (p=0.006). The physician should further improve early detection for LBW babies by monitoring high-risk pregnancy mothers routinely.
